What Does Natural Really Mean?
The first step is to identify clearly what makes some protein powders unnatural. In some cases, unnatural protein powders contain ingredients that are heavily processed. In other cases, ingredients are chemicals not intended for normal food consumption. Some protein powders are also considered unhealthy because of the way they are processed by manufacturers.
Some of the ingredients often found in unnatural protein powders include the following:
- GMO
- Pesticides
- Preservatives
- Artificial sweeteners
- Refined sugar
- Hormones
Some protein powders are considered unnatural because they are not processed in the cleanest way possible. This means some of the nutritional value of the protein is lost during processing, creating an inferior protein powder that doesn’t stack up well against higher-quality competitors.
Selecting Natural Protein Powder
The best natural protein powder is not likely to be found at the local discount store or supermarket. For natural products with minimal or high-quality processing, look at the ingredient label on each package. You should be able to determine what most ingredients are, and a quick Google search will tell you what some of the lesser known ingredients are and whether they are natural food products.
Natural protein powders will not feature mile-long ingredient lists with long words you don’t understand. They will feature ingredients that you have encountered in life before and which you can learn about without extensive research.
